AUCTION ITEM This auction is for a fine old antique nautical brass telescope. It consists of three pieces: 1.) Brass telescope with aluminum endpieces, aluminum and brass fittings. There are no identification markings of any kind on the scope - I don't know what magnification the lens provides, nor do I know the manufacturer. It is just over 31 inches long, fully extended, and weighs 2 lbs 13 ozs. Outside diameter of the main tube is 1.5". 2.) A heavy aluminum and brass fork mount that weighs 1 lb. 7 ozs. 3.) A heavy wood and brass tripod which is probably the most interesting part of the telescope. It has a Cast brass head with 2 rack and pinion angle adjustments and a liquid bubble level. Individual part numbers are cast or stamped into most of the metal pieces but there is no manufacturer data. It weighs 11-1/2 lbs and full leg extension is 6' 1". CONDITION All of the adjustments and locking mechanism work properly. There is some plating wear at the top end of the leg extensions and a few small spots of surface corrosion further down the legs.
